重楼皂苷VII对IL-1β诱导的关节软骨细胞凋亡和分泌炎症介质的影响

中文摘要:
      目的 探讨重楼皂苷VII对IL-1β诱导的关节软骨细胞凋亡和分泌炎症介质的影响。方法 分离培养人膝关节软骨细胞,分成对照组、模型组、低(0.1 μg/mL)、中(0.2 μg/mL)、高剂量组(0.4 μg/mL)、中剂量+Vector组、中剂量+TLR4组,CCK-8法检测细胞增殖,流式细胞术检测细胞凋亡,ELISA法分析TNF-α、PGE2水平,比色法检测NO水平,Western blot检测TLR4、C-Caspase-3、MMP-13、MMP-1、MMP-3蛋白表达。结果 与对照组比较,模型组细胞存活率下降,细胞凋亡率上升,TLR4、C-Caspase-3、MMP-13、MMP-1、MMP-3蛋白水平和TNF-α、NO、PGE2水平升高。与模型组比较,低、中、高剂量组细胞存活率上升,细胞凋亡率降低,TLR4、C-Caspase-3、MMP-13、MMP-1、MMP-3蛋白水平和TNF-α、NO、PGE2水平降低。与中剂量+Vector组比较,中剂量+TLR4组细胞存活率降低,细胞凋亡率升高,TLR4、C-Caspase-3、MMP-13、MMP-1、MMP-3蛋白水平和TNF-α、NO、PGE2水平升高。结论 重楼皂苷VII抑制IL-1β诱导的关节软骨细胞凋亡、分泌炎症介质和MMP-13、MMP-1、MMP-3蛋白表达,机制与降低TLR4有关。
英文摘要:
      Objective To investigate the effects of polyphyllin VII on apoptosis and secretion of inflammatory mediators of articular chondrocytes induced by IL-1β. Methods Human knee articular cartilage chondrocytes were isolated and cultured. Cells were divided into Control, Model group, low- (0.1μg/mL), middle- (0.2μg/mL), and high-dose (0.4μg/mL) group, middle dose+Vector group, and middle dose+TLR4 group. Cell proliferation was detected with CCK-8 method. Cell apoptosis was detected with flow cytometry, The levels of TNF-α and PGE2 were analyzed with ELISA. The level of NO was detected with colorimetry. The protein expressions of TLR4, C-Caspase-3, MMP-13, MMP-1, and MMP-3 were detected with Western blotting. Results Compared with those in the Control group, cell survival rate in the Model group decreased, the cell apoptosis rate increased, and the levels of TLR4, C-Caspase-3, MMP-13, MMP-1, and MMP-3 protein and TNF-α, NO, PGE2 increased. Compared with those in IL-1β group, the cell survival rate in low-, middle-, and high-dose groups gradually increased, the apoptosis rate gradually decreased, and the levels of TLR4, C-Caspase-3, MMP-13, MMP-1, MMP-3 protein and TNF-α, NO and PGE2 decreased. Compared with the middle dose+Vector group, the middle dose+TLR4 group had a lower cell survival rate and an increased cell apoptosis rate. The levels of TLR4, C-Caspase-3, MMP-13, MMP-1, MMP-3 protein and TNF-α, NO, PGE2 increased. Conclusion Polyphyllin VII inhibits IL-1β-induced apoptosis, secretion of inflammatory mediators, and the expression of MMP-13, MMP-1, and MMP-3 proteins of articular chondrocytes. The mechanism is related to the reduction of TLR4.
